2. Difficulties Of Reusing Solar Panels



It is commonly accepted that reusing photovoltaic panels has lots of environmental benefits, however, it is also real that the procedure isn't without its difficulties. Yet what exactly are these difficulties? Let's check out additionally.



Among the greatest problems with reusing solar panels is the intricacy of the job itself. It can be tough to break down the different elements, such as glass and metal, to be reused separately. In addition, solar panel manufacturers typically have a mix of products utilized in their items which makes sorting them much more difficult. Additionally, there are safety and health dangers involved with handling broken glass or breathing in fumes from melting parts.

Another vital challenge associated with recycling photovoltaic panels is cost. Many countries do not have enough framework or resources to effectively reuse these items which brings about greater expenditures for businesses attempting to do so. In addition, as a result of the specialized nature of recycling solar panels, this can develop a financial burden on firms trying to remain compliant with policies. Ultimately, these prices could be passed down to customers making it challenging for them to pay for renewable resource sources.

3. Strategies For Reusing Solar Panels



As the globe pursues a more sustainable future, reusing solar panels is an increasingly preferred task. Amidst this expanding rate of interest, nonetheless, we should consider the approaches that remain in location to make it feasible.

To begin with, several firms have carried out a 'take-back' system where old or damaged photovoltaic panels can be accumulated and sent to their particular factories for reusing. By doing this, the materials are able to be recycled in the building of brand-new items. In addition, some municipalities have even begun supplying motivations for people wishing to reuse their photovoltaic panels; this might range from tax breaks to cost-free shipping costs.

Furthermore, innovation has ended up being increasingly advanced when it pertains to recycling solar panels-- with specialist makers with the ability of separating out all the various components within them. For example, by utilizing AI-powered robotic arms, these devices can remove valuable products such as copper and aluminium while also dealing with contaminated materials safely. Therefore, this procedure is both time and cost effective-- permitting us to make better use our resources whilst keeping our atmosphere tidy.
